Evander made his long-awaited return to Portland on Saturday, where he embraced a new role previously unfamiliar to him in the city: the villain.
Evander, a 27-year-old Brazilian national, previously played for two seasons with the Portland Timbers between 2023 and 2024. Advertisement
He then joined FC Cincinnati earlier this year in February in a cash-for-player trade that was worth $12 million. The exchange broke the record for the most expensive purchase between two MLS teams in the league's 31-year history.
